Abstract: (APS)
The quantum dynamics of a self-gravitating thin matter shell in vacuum has been considered. The quantum Hamiltonian of the system is positive definite. Within a chosen set of parameters, the quantum shell bounces above the horizon. The considered quantum system does not collapse to the gravitational singularity of the corresponding classical system.Note:
